About The Expo and (What To Expect!)
The Coalition of Non-Profits Community Health & Help Expo is designed to bring together hundreds of nonprofits, healthcare providers, workforce organizations, educational institutions, and community partners under one roof to connect individuals and families with real resources, real opportunities, and real support.

Workshops & Classes
We’ll have 10 different areas with interactive classes & workshops designed to transform embolden, and empower.

Hundreds of Resources
The Resource Hall is the heartbeat of the event, bringing together over 300 nonprofits and community resources.

Job Opportunities
We’ll have over 40 different organizations, trade unions, and training programs recruiting talent on the spot.
Explore Our Resources Hubs
CommunityConnect Resource Hall is where help meets access. With more than 300 nonprofit organizations and service providers under one roof, community members of all walks of life can connect directly with valuable programs to help with everything from food insecurity and housing to educational and career oppportunities, enterpreneurship, veterans services, health and wellness, legal/financial/insurance help, and support for family and caregivers – from newborns to seniors.

FAQs
Answers to some of the frequently asked questions about The 2026 Coalition of Non-profits Health & Help Expo
Is There A Fee To Attend The Expo?
No. Admission To Both The Expo and The ConnectVirtual Online Content Hub are completely free to all.
Who Is The Expo For?
The Expo is for everybody looking for a hand up. From Job Seekers to families needing healthcare access, senior services, and so much more, you can find resources for any and every kind of help you need at the Coalition of Non-profits Health & Help Expo.
What Time is The Expo?
The Expo will run on June 20th from 10 am to 8 pm. We will publish a full schedule of our sessions and workshops closer to the event. The CommunityConnect Resource Hall will be open to peruse the entire time, and the ConnectVirtual Online Content Hub will go live on June 15th and be active for an entire year.
